Abstract

A kind of flexible clutch, relate to a kind of shaft coupling, including two joints, a piece flexible pipe and two clamp nuts, the two ends of flexible pipe are connected with two joints respectively, two joints are connected with driving shaft to be connected and driven axle respectively, two joints all include axle connecting portion and are co-axially located at the pipe jointing part of axle connecting portion one end, the two ends swelling of flexible pipe is on the outer wall of the pipe jointing part of two joints, two clamp nuts are respectively sleeved at the two ends of flexible pipe and the junction of two joints, clamp nut one end connects with corresponding joint screw thread, the other end by the respective end lock ring of flexible pipe on the pipe jointing part of joint.This utility model can be used in the connection having two axles of relatively large deviation in axiality when low torque drive, reduces manufacture and installation accuracy, and stable drive is reliable, with low cost.

Description

A kind of flexible clutch
Technical field
This utility model relates to a kind of shaft coupling, is specifically related to a kind of flexible clutch.
Background technology
Rotary encoder is a kind of device for measuring rotating speed, in use requires the highest to its installation accuracy, If alignment error is big, such as eccentric, drift angle, just has excessive load and be added on axle, thus cause damage or shorten it and make Use the life-span.Existing common cross-axle universal shaft coupling angle compensation ability is strong, bearing capacity big, can transmit bigger moment of torsion, But its structure is complicated, manufacturing cost is higher, for two connecting shaft coaxiality deviations bigger in the case of the most applicable.In this situation Under, urgent needs one simple in construction, use reliably, and disclosure satisfy that two axles have the Novel connected of relatively large deviation situation installation requirement Axial organ.
Utility model content
The purpose of this utility model is to provide a kind of flexible clutch, and it allows driving shaft and driven axle to have in axiality Bigger deviation, it is possible to effectively solve driving shaft, driven axle out-of-alignment problem during low torque drive.
For achieving the above object, the technical solution of the utility model is: a kind of flexible clutch, connects including two Head, a flexible pipe and two clamp nuts, the two ends of flexible pipe are connected with two joints respectively, and two joints are respectively with to be connected Driving shaft and driven axle connect, and two joints all include axle connecting portion and are co-axially located at the pipe jointing part of axle connecting portion one end, The two ends swelling of flexible pipe is on the outer wall of the pipe jointing part of two joints, and two clamp nuts are respectively sleeved at the two ends and two of flexible pipe The junction of joint, clamp nut one end connects with corresponding joint screw thread, the other end by the respective end lock ring of flexible pipe at joint Pipe jointing part on.
Further, the pipe jointing part of described two joints all includes cylindrical section and the frustum section being coaxially disposed, cylindrical section One end is connected with the axle connecting portion of joint, and the other end is connected with the larger diameter end of frustum section, and the diameter of cylindrical section is less than frustum section The diameter of larger diameter end, the swelling respectively of the two ends of flexible pipe is on the cylindrical section of corresponding joint and the outer wall of frustum section.
Beneficial effect: flexible clutch of the present utility model uses flexible pipe to connect driving shaft with passive by two joints Axle, reduces driving shaft and the requirement of driven axle axiality.When low torque drive, it is possible to bigger for having in axiality The connection of two axles of deviation, reduces manufacture and installation accuracy, efficiently solves driving shaft and driven axle when low moment of torsion rotates Out-of-alignment problem, stable drive is reliable, with low cost.

Detailed description of the invention
As it is shown in figure 1, a kind of flexible clutch, including 1, flexible pipe 3 of two joints and two clamp nuts 2, flexible pipe 3 Two ends be connected with two joints 1 respectively, two joints 1 are connected with driving shaft to be connected and driven axle respectively.Two joints 1 All including axle connecting portion and be co-axially located at the pipe jointing part of axle connecting portion one end, axle connecting portion is used for installing driving shaft or driven Axle, pipe jointing part is used for connecting flexible pipe 3.The axle connecting portion of two joints 1 all includes the cylinder of two sections of different-diameters, two sections of circles The inside of cylinder is axially arranged with axle installing hole.The pipe jointing part of two joints 1 all includes cylindrical section 4 and the frustum section 5 being coaxially disposed, One end of cylindrical section 4 is connected with the axle connecting portion of joint 1, and the other end is connected with the larger diameter end of frustum section 5, cylindrical section 4 straight Footpath is less than the diameter of frustum section 5 larger diameter end, and so, swelling is distinguished at the cylindrical section 4 of corresponding joint 1 and cone in the two ends of flexible pipe 3 On the outer wall of platform section 5, and owing to cylindrical section 4 is different with frustum section 5 diameter, there is projection in both junctions, make flexible pipe 3 not allow Easily come off from joint 1.Two clamp nuts 2 are respectively sleeved at the two ends of flexible pipe 3 and the junction of two joints 1, for by soft The two ends of pipe 3 are fastened on two joints 1.Described clamp nut 2 one end is threaded with corresponding joint 1, and the other end is by flexible pipe 3 Respective end lock ring on the pipe jointing part of joint 1, the thrust of two clamp nuts 2 allows low torque drive.Two clamp nuts 2 From its one end threadeded with corresponding joint 1 to the other end, it is divided into large diameter section, reducer and little internal diameter section, imperial palace After the corresponding joint of footpath Duan Yu 1 is threaded, utilize its little internal diameter section that the respective end of flexible pipe 3 is pressed on joint 1 pipe jointing part Frustum section 5 on.
Flexible clutch flexible pipe 3 of the present utility model connects driving shaft and driven axle by two joints 1, can absorb The coaxiality error of two connecting shafts, the alternative Hooks coupling universal coupling when low torque drive.During installation, first two clamp nuts 2 are overlapped On flexible pipe 3, then it is locked after the two ends of flexible pipe 3 are swollen at the cylindrical section 4 of two joint 1 pipe jointing parts and the outer wall of frustum section 5 On, screw two clamp nuts 2 the most respectively, and make its one end be threaded on the axle connecting portion of two joints 1, two clamp nuts Flexible pipe 3 is pressed in the frustum section 5 of two joint 1 pipe jointing parts by the other end of 2, thus is connect with two respectively at the two ends of flexible pipe 3 1 fixes, and is finally connected with driving shaft and driven axle respectively by two joints 1.
